json格式文件怎么打开?

262 2024-02-24 16:28

一、json格式文件怎么打开?

步骤/方式1

在电脑桌面上找到json格式的文件,使用鼠标左键该双击该文件

步骤/方式2

然后勾选“从已安装程序列表中选择程序”,点击“确定”

步骤/方式3

接着选择工具“记事本”,点击“确定”

步骤/方式4

这样就可以用记事本工具将json文件打开了

二、json格式文件批量转excel格式?

要将批量的JSON格式文件转换为Excel格式,您可以使用Python编程语言和相应的库来实现。以下是一种可能的方法,使用`pandas`库来处理JSON数据和生成Excel文件。

首先,确保您已安装`pandas`库。您可以使用以下命令通过pip进行安装:

```

pip install pandas

```

一旦安装了`pandas`,您可以使用以下代码批量将JSON文件转换为Excel文件:

```python

import os

import pandas as pd

# 输入文件夹路径和输出文件名

input_folder = '/path/to/json/files'

output_file = '/path/to/output/excel.xlsx'

# 获取输入文件夹中的所有JSON文件

json_files = [file for file in os.listdir(input_folder) if file.endswith('.json')]

# 创建一个空的DataFrame来存储所有JSON数据

all_data = pd.DataFrame()

# 遍历每个JSON文件并将其读取为DataFrame

for file in json_files:

    file_path = os.path.join(input_folder, file)

    with open(file_path, 'r') as json_file:

        json_data = pd.read_json(json_file)

        all_data = all_data.append(json_data, ignore_index=True)

# 将DataFrame保存为Excel文件

all_data.to_excel(output_file, index=False)

```

请注意,您需要将`/path/to/json/files`替换为包含您的JSON文件的实际文件夹路径,并将`/path/to/output/excel.xlsx`替换为要生成的Excel文件的实际输出路径。

这段代码将逐个遍历JSON文件夹中的每个JSON文件,并将其读取为`DataFrame`,然后将所有数据合并到一个`DataFrame`中。最后,它将使用`to_excel()`方法将`DataFrame`保存为Excel文件。

请确保您的JSON文件具有适当的结构,以便能够正确地读取和转换为`DataFrame`。如果JSON文件的结构与预期不符,您可能需要根据实际情况进行一些额外的数据处理和转换。

三、json格式文件存储的是什么数据?

JSON格式文件存储的是数据。它是一种轻量级的数据交换格式。JSON文件由键值对或数组组成。键值对的形式是"key":"value",其中key是字符串,value可以是字符串、数字、布尔值、数组或另一个JSON对象。数组则由一组数据组成,可以是字符串、数字、布尔值、数组或JSON对象。JSON文件一般用来存储和传输结构化数据,如配置文件、API返回结果等。

四、json格式文件怎么转换成excel?

json格式文件转换成excel方法如下:手动将JSON转化为Excel

1. 使用文本编辑器打开JSON格式文件,将其保存为CSV格式,即将JSON文件中的逗号替换为分号,将括号替换为空格等等。

2. 使用Excel打开CSV文件,选择文件中的所有数据,并按照Excel提供的导入CSV文件格式的指导进行导入。

五、json?

一 简介:JSON(JavaScript对象符号)是一种轻量级的数据交换格式。这是很容易为人类所读取和写入。这是易于机器解析和生成。它是基于JavaScript编程语言的一个子集 , 标准ECMA-262第三版- 1999年12月。JSON是一个完全独立于语言的文本格式,但使用C家族的语言,包括C,C + +,C#,Java中的JavaScript,Perl的,Python中,和许多其他程序员所熟悉的约定。这些特性使JSON成为理想的数据交换语言。他和map很类似,都是以键/值 对存放的。

六、json格式?

JSON(JavaScript Object Notation, JS 对象简谱) 是一种轻量级的数据交换格式。它基于 ECMAScript (欧洲计算机协会制定的js规范)的一个子集,采用完全独立于编程语言的文本格式来存储和表示数据。

简洁和清晰的层次结构使得 JSON 成为理想的数据交换语言。易于人阅读和编写,同时也易于机器解析和生成,并有效地提升网络传输效率。

七、json 规范?

JSON是一种基于JavaScript语法的轻量级数据交换格式,由于其简单易用、支持跨平台等特性,越来越被应用于Web编程领域。

下面是JSON规范的一些基本要点:

1. 数据类型:JSON有字符串、数值、布尔、对象、数组、null六种数据类型。

2. 数据格式:JSON中数据以键值对的方式组织成一个个对象。键值对由一个键名和对应的值组成,用冒号“:”隔开。多个键值对之间用逗号“,”隔开,整个对象用大括号“{}”包围起来。

3. 数组格式:JSON中还可以包含数组,数组中的元素可以是以上5种数据类型和数组类型,多个元素之间也用逗号隔开,整个数组由中括号[] 包围。

4. 嵌套格式:JSON可以嵌套使用,即一个JSON对象的某个键的值可以是另一个JSON对象或一个JSON数组。

下面是一个简单的JSON示例:

```json

    "name": "Lucy",

    "age": 18,

    "gender": "female",

    "hobbies": [

        "reading",

        "traveling",

        "playing games"

    ],

    "address": {

        "country": "China",

        "province": "Guangdong",

        "city": "Shenzhen"

    }

}

```

其中:

- "name"、 "age"、 "gender"、 "hobbies" 和 "address" 是键,分别代表名字、年龄、性别、爱好和地址。

- "Lucy"、18、"female"、["reading","traveling","playing games"] 和 {"country":"China","province":"Guangdong","city":"Shenzhen"} 是相应键的对应值。

也就是说,这个JSON对象的内容描述了一个人的信息。

希望这些内容对你有所帮助。

八、php表示json

使用PHP将数据表示为JSON格式

在现代的Web开发中,JSON格式已成为数据交换的标准。无论是客户端与服务器之间的通信,还是API的数据传输,都经常使用JSON格式进行数据表示。PHP作为一种强大的服务器端语言,也提供了许多功能来处理和表示JSON数据。本文将介绍如何使用PHP将数据表示为JSON格式。

1. PHP的JSON函数

PHP提供了一组强大的函数来处理JSON数据。我们可以使用这些函数将PHP的数据结构转换为JSON格式,或者反过来将JSON字符串转换为PHP的数据结构。以下是一些常用的函数:

  • json_encode():将PHP的数据结构转换为JSON字符串。
  • json_decode():将JSON字符串转换为PHP的数据结构。
  • json_last_error():获取最近一次JSON操作的错误代码。

2. 将PHP的数组表示为JSON格式

要将PHP的数组表示为JSON格式,我们可以使用json_encode()函数。下面是一个示例:

<?php $data = array( 'name' => '张三', 'age' => 25, 'email' => 'zhangsan@example.com' ); $json = json_encode($data); echo $json; ?>

运行上述代码,将输出以下JSON字符串:

{"name":"张三","age":25,"email":"zhangsan@example.com"}

从上面的示例中可以看出,json_encode()函数将关联数组转换为具有相应键值对的JSON字符串。

3. JSON的高级表示

除了简单的关联数组,PHP的数据结构还支持更复杂的JSON表示。例如,我们可以使用嵌套的数组和对象来构建更复杂的数据结构。下面是一个示例:

<?php
  $data = array(
    'name' => '张三',
    'age' => 25,
    'email' => 'zhangsan@example.com',
    'education' => array(
      'university' => '清华大学',
      'major' => '计算机科学',
      'degree' => '学士'
    ),
    'skills' => array('PHP', 'JavaScript', '', 'CSS')
  );

  $json = json_encode($data);

  echo $json;
?>

运行上述代码,将输出以下JSON字符串:

{
  "name": "张三",
  "age": 25,
  "email": "zhangsan@example.com",
  "education": {
    "university": "清华大学",
    "major": "计算机科学",
    "degree": "学士"
  },
  "skills": ["PHP", "JavaScript", "HTML", "CSS"]
}

从上面的示例中可以看出,我们可以使用嵌套的数组和对象来表示更复杂的JSON结构。这对于表示像树状结构或多层次关系的数据非常有用。

4. 在PHP中解析JSON

要将JSON字符串解析为PHP的数据结构,我们可以使用json_decode()函数。下面是一个示例:

<?php
  $json = '{"name":"张三","age":25,"email":"zhangsan@example.com"}';

  $data = json_decode($json, true);

  echo $data['name'];  // 输出:张三
  echo $data['age'];   // 输出:25
?>

从上述示例中可以看出,json_decode()函数将JSON字符串转换为PHP的数据结构。

5. 错误处理

使用JSON函数时,我们还需要注意错误处理。如果在处理JSON时出现错误,我们可以使用json_last_error()函数获取错误代码。以下是一些常见的错误代码:

  • JSON_ERROR_NONE:没有错误发生。
  • JSON_ERROR_DEPTH:达到了最大堆栈深度。
  • JSON_ERROR_STATE_MISMATCH:无效或异常的 JSON。
  • JSON_ERROR_CTRL_CHAR:控制字符错误。
  • JSON_ERROR_SYNTAX:语法错误。
  • JSON_ERROR_UTF8:异常的 UTF-8 字符,可能是因为错误的编码。

我们可以根据错误代码采取相应的处理措施,例如输出错误信息或记录错误日志。

结论

使用PHP将数据表示为JSON格式是一项非常常见而重要的任务。本文介绍了PHP中可用的JSON函数,并提供了一些示例来演示如何将PHP的数据结构表示为JSON格式。同时,我们也学习了如何在PHP中解析JSON字符串。通过这些知识,我们可以更好地处理和交换数据,使我们的Web应用程序更加强大和灵活。

九、php json 程序

PHP和JSON的程序开发指南

随着现代互联网技术的飞速发展,数据的传输和交互变得越来越重要。在许多网络应用中,PHP和JSON被广泛应用于数据的处理和交换。本文将为您提供一个关于PHP和JSON的程序开发指南,帮助您快速入门并掌握这两个强大工具。

什么是PHP?

PHP(超文本预处理器)是一种广泛用于Web开发的服务器端脚本语言。它是一种通用的编程语言,可以嵌入到中,以动态生成Web页面内容。PHP具有灵活性、易学易用的特点,因此成为了许多网站和应用程序的首选开发语言。

PHP可以执行各种任务,包括但不限于数据库操作、表单处理、文件上传和数据处理。它拥有大量的内置函数和扩展,方便快捷地实现各种功能。与其他编程语言相比,PHP的学习曲线相对较低,因此非常适合初学者进入Web开发领域。

什么是JSON?

JSON(JavaScript对象表示法)是一种轻量级的数据交换格式,常用于Web应用中的数据传输和存储。它以简洁的文本组织数据,易于阅读和编写,并能够与不同的编程语言进行无缝交互。

JSON采用键值对的形式来表示数据,使用对象和数组的结构来组织复杂的数据。它支持字符串、数字、布尔值、数组、对象和null等数据类型。JSON的格式简洁、明确,非常适合在不同平台和系统之间传递数据。

PHP中的JSON处理

PHP提供了一系列的函数用于处理JSON数据。下面是一些常用的PHP JSON函数:

  • json_encode():将PHP数组或对象转换为JSON字符串。
  • json_decode():将JSON字符串转换为PHP数组或对象。
  • json_encode():将JSON字符串转换为PHP数组或对象。
  • json_encode():将JSON字符串转换为PHP数组或对象。

通过这些函数,我们可以轻松地在PHP中进行JSON数据的编码和解码操作。例如,通过json_encode()函数,我们可以将PHP数组转换为JSON字符串,并在网络中传输或存储;通过json_decode()函数,我们可以将接收到的JSON字符串解析为PHP数组,方便后续的数据处理和操作。

示例:PHP和JSON的应用

让我们来看一个示例,演示如何在PHP中使用JSON进行数据交换和处理:

十、php 变更 json

在现代的网络应用程序开发中,数据的内部交换和存储是至关重要的。常见的数据格式之一是JSON(JavaScript Object Notation)。

JSON是一种轻量级的数据交换格式,广泛用于前端和后端之间的数据传输和存储。它具有简洁、易读和易于解析的特点,因此被广泛应用于各种编程语言和框架中。

PHP和JSON的结合

PHP是一种功能强大的服务器端脚本语言,特别适用于处理Web请求和生成动态内容。PHP提供了丰富的内置函数和库,使得与JSON的交互变得异常简单。

无论是在PHP应用程序中读取现有的JSON数据,还是在生成JSON响应时,PHP都提供了一系列方法帮助我们处理和操作JSON。

现在,让我们来看看一些常见的PHP函数和方法,这些函数和方法可用于操作JSON数据。

json_encode()

json_encode()函数是PHP中一个非常重要的函数,用于将PHP变量转换为JSON格式的字符串。这个函数接受一个参数,即待编码的PHP变量,并返回JSON字符串。

下面是一个基本的例子:

'John', 'age' => 30, 'city' => 'Beijing'); $jsonString = json_encode($data); echo $jsonString; ?>

上述代码将输出以下JSON格式的字符串:


{"name":"John","age":30,"city":"Beijing"}

我们可以看到,json_encode()函数将关联数组转换为了JSON格式的字符串。

json_decode()

json_decode()函数是json_encode()函数的逆操作。它将JSON格式的字符串转换为PHP变量。

下面是一个例子:




上述代码将输出以下结果:


stdClass Object
(
    [name] => John
    [age] => 30
    [city] => Beijing
)

我们可以看到,json_decode()函数将JSON数据解码为了一个PHP对象。

更新和修改JSON数据

除了编码和解码JSON数据,我们经常需要更新和修改JSON数据。PHP提供了一些方法来实现这些操作。

首先,我们需要将JSON字符串解码为PHP变量,然后在PHP中对其进行修改,最后再将修改后的PHP变量编码为JSON字符串。

下面是一个例子:


age = 31;

// 重新编码为JSON字符串
$newJsonString = json_encode($data);
echo $newJsonString;
?>

上述代码将输出以下JSON字符串:


{"name":"John","age":31,"city":"Beijing"}

我们可以看到,通过修改PHP变量中的属性值,并重新编码为JSON字符串,我们成功地更新了JSON数据。

总结

在本文中,我们介绍了PHP与JSON的结合使用。我们了解了如何使用json_encode()函数将PHP变量编码为JSON格式的字符串,并使用json_decode()函数将JSON字符串解码为PHP变量。此外,我们还学习了如何更新和修改JSON数据。

PHP提供了强大而灵活的方法来处理JSON数据,使得构建现代的网络应用程序变得更加高效和方便。

在开发过程中,我们应该充分利用PHP提供的这些功能和方法,以实现与前端的无缝数据交换和持久化存储。

顶一下
(0)
0%
踩一下
(0)
0%
相关评论
我要评论
点击我更换图片